- Flash (Temporary Debugging File) by Adobe Systems IncorporatedAdobe Flash, initially known as Shockwave Flash and popularly called simply Flash, refers to both the Adobe Flash Player and to the Adobe Flash Professional multimedia authoring program. The Flash Player, developed and distributed by Adobe Systems (which acquired Macromedia in a merger that was finalized in December 2005), is a client application available in most common web browsers. SWD files are temporary debugging files used during Flash development. Once finished developing a Flash project these files are not needed and can be removed. The identifying characters used for this association are - Hex: 46 57 44, ASCII: FWD.

- Settlers II (Map) by Ubisoft EntertainmentBlue Byte is one of the pioneers of the German gaming industry. Today, Blue Byte is a 100% subsidiary of Ubisoft. The identifying characters used for this association are - Hex: 57 4F 52 4C 44 5F 56 31 2E 30, ASCII: WORLD_V1.0. Related links: Settlers II Information Site

SWD file format:
Why is it important to know the file format? This is the only way to find out which program to use to open the file. The file format can be determined based on the file extension and the signature (the first few characters of a file). Nonetheless, different programs can utilize the same file extension to represent distinct file formats. Double-clicking on the file often results in an error when opening. Exact knowledge of the format is therefore important in order to solve problems occurring in files. Our evaluation of the SWD files looks like this:
The SWD file extension is rather rarely used and includes many different file formats. However, the following two file formats are common:
- 20% of all SWD files use the same file format, which have the signature SWD. These files are plain text, which means they can be viewed with any text editor such as Windows Editor, Nano for Linux, and TextEdit for macOS. The file size is in the range of 45 KB to 5 MB. Certain words are almost always found in the files, such as SWDE.w.2.00.(C) GUGiK 2000;, dane, C; Data modu, Kontekst danych, u swde, 31 Tryb, Alters, C; Dane aktualne, C; Przedzia, czasowy: Brak and wymagany: 90:31.
- 15% of all SWD files are Flash file with debug info files. They consist of unreadable binary data. The files are 24 bytes to 150 KB in size, with a median of 70 KB. The keywords Name are typical for these files. Some examples of file names are RootMovie.swd.
The remaining 65% of all SWD files are different files with different signatures, the following 6 formats can be found: Storybook Weaver Deluxe for Windows Story and Settlers II map.
